Culann's Hounds are a traditional Irish folk band from San Francisco, California, United States.
Founded in 1999 by Steve Gardner and Michael Kelleher as The Irish Bastards, the band began playing gigs and soon adopted the more broadly appealing name.
Their second album, Year of the Dog, was released March 17, 2006 (St. Patrick's Day) at the Great American Music Hall.
The Hounds have returned to headline the Great American Music hall for St. Patrick's Day each year from 2007 to the present.
The Hounds have toured in the United States and Europe, playing concerts and festivals with numerous top shelf acts from various genres, and every Irish band of note.
